在网络科技迅猛发展的今天,Clash脚本作为一种重要的网络代理工具,越来越受到用户的关注。本文将从多个角度探讨Clash脚本的定义、功能、使用方法及其常见问题,帮助用户全面了解这一工具。
什么是Clash脚本?
Clash脚本是一种用来配置和管理网络代理的工具。它是基于Clash这一开源项目而创建,旨在提供一种高效、灵活的代理服务。Clash脚本允许用户定义不同的网络规则,以便在不同的网络环境中快速切换和管理流量。
Clash脚本的主要功能
Clash脚本具备以下主要功能:
- 流量分流:根据用户设定的规则,自动将不同的流量导向相应的代理服务器。
- 多种协议支持:支持多种网络协议,包括但不限于 HTTP、HTTPS 和 SOCKS5。
- 动态规则更新:能够实时更新代理规则,确保网络连接的稳定性与安全性。
- 自定义配置:用户可以根据需要,自行编辑和配置代理规则,实现个性化需求。
- 监控与日志:提供实时的网络监控和日志记录功能,便于用户追踪流量状态与故障排查。
如何使用Clash脚本?
1. 安装Clash
在使用Clash脚本之前,首先需要安装Clash。安装步骤如下:
- 下载Clash的最新版本。
- 解压缩下载的文件。
- 根据操作系统的不同,使用终端命令或图形界面进行安装。
2. 创建Clash脚本
创建Clash脚本通常需要一些基本的编程知识。以下是一个简单的步骤:
- 打开文本编辑器,创建一个新的配置文件。
- 按照Clash的配置规范,编写网络规则。例如,定义代理服务器地址、端口及访问控制。
3. 启动Clash并加载脚本
- 启动Clash程序。
- 在Clash的设置中,选择“加载脚本”,并选择之前创建的配置文件。
- 确认无误后,保存并应用设置。
Clash脚本的使用场景
Clash脚本的使用场景相当广泛,主要包括:
- 科学上网:帮助用户绕过网络限制,安全访问被屏蔽的网站。
- 公司网络:为企业用户提供灵活的网络访问控制,保障公司数据安全。
- 游戏加速:通过代理服务器降低游戏延迟,提高游戏体验。
Clash脚本常见问题
Q1: Clash脚本可以在什么设备上使用?
Clash脚本可以在多种操作系统上使用,包括 Windows、macOS 和 Linux 等。部分移动设备如 Android 和 iOS 也有相关的实现。
Q2: Clash脚本的配置复杂吗?
Clash脚本的配置相对简单,但对初学者而言可能会有一定的学习曲线。掌握基本的网络知识后,配置难度会大大降低。
Q3: Clash脚本是否支持多用户使用?
Clash脚本可以配置为支持多个用户,通过设置不同的访问控制策略,实现多人共用一个代理服务。
Q4: 如何解决Clash脚本连接失败的问题?
- 检查网络连接是否正常。
- 确保配置文件中代理服务器地址及端口正确。
- 查看Clash的日志信息,以便定位故障原因。
Q5: Clash脚本更新后是否需要重新配置?
一般情况下,更新Clash脚本不会影响已有的配置。但如果更新涉及到协议或参数的重大改变,建议备份配置文件,并根据新的规范进行调整。
结论
总之,Clash脚本作为一种功能强大的网络代理工具,凭借其灵活的配置和强大的功能,已经成为网络用户不可或缺的工具之一。通过本文的详细解析,相信用户可以更好地理解和使用Clash脚本,提高自己的网络体验。
正文完